Systems Administrator – Infrastructure & Cloud
Requirements
Must have:
– I hold a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science or any relevant equivalent training. – I have a minimum of 10 years of experience in information technologies, particularly in the field of infrastructure. – I possess at least one Microsoft Azure certification, such as AZ-900, AZ-104, SC-300, AZ-500, or AZ-400. – I have proven expertise in Azure environments (administration, integration, and security). – I have practical knowledge of automation tools and scripting (PowerShell, Batch, IaC). – I have experience in incident management, migrations, and large-scale infrastructure projects. – I have a deep understanding of information security issues in an organizational or governmental context.
Responsibilities:
- I will install, configure, and maintain servers and virtualized environments (Windows, Linux, VMware, AS/400). – I will design, deploy, and optimize cloud environments on Azure (VMs, App Services, databases, AKS containers). – I will automate the provisioning and management of resources using PowerShell, Azure CLI, ARM, or Bicep. – I will manage essential infrastructure services (Active Directory, Exchange, GPO, DNS, DHCP, WSUS, ADFS). – I will set up and administer hybrid architectures: integrating on-premises environments with Azure (VPN, Azure AD Connect, ExpressRoute, etc.). – I will ensure proactive system monitoring (Azure Monitor, Log Analytics, Application Insights) and respond to critical incidents. – I will implement best security practices: MFA, Azure policies, GPO configuration, and hardening of environments. – I will participate in migration projects (to the cloud or to new system versions) and in technological upgrades. – I will produce technical documentation (installation guides, procedures, automation scripts) and contribute to knowledge transfer.
